Training

Macaws are intelligent birds that thrive when they are handled regularly, provided with stimulation and exercise, and with regular attention. They love playing, exploring their surroundings and manipulating objects. They will also enjoy being "skritched", or cuddled when they are at ease with their companion.

Macaws that aren't properly handled can become territorial, aggressive, or destructive. People who are bored may be prone to using feathers as a form of self-mutilation. To avoid boredom, offer plenty of toys that are textured and multiple perches. Utilizing toys that simulate preening will also help keep feathers from being destroyed by boredom. Talk to a trained avian behaviorist or vet if any of these behaviors occur.

Young macaws that are raised by hand are able to adapt to new surroundings and training. Introduce them to new people, car trips and hospital visits as well as other pets (including cats and dogs) and other birds from a young age. They are easily influenced and require consistent handling from an early age to avoid them from developing relationships with one person. If this happens, parrots are likely to scream to be noticed and could even begin to bite. The ability to lead, discipline and patience are key to changing these behavior patterns.

Larger macaws such as the Blue and Gold, Scarlet, Military and Hyacinth are more susceptible to behavioral problems as they grow older. Hormonal imbalances can lead to anxiety and depression. These problems can become serious health issues and create a stressful situation for the pet owner and the parrot.

Regularly trim the macaw's nail. This helps in handling the bird, and also the nails are less likely to be caught on cages or toys. The shorter nails also help keep the bird clean and healthy.

The cage size for a macaw's cage is extremely important, since these massive birds require a lot of space to run and fly around. It is recommended that the cage be at least 3 feet wide 2 feet deep and 6 feet tall. These large birds should be able spread their wings during flight and also have enough space for toys, climbing and perching.

If your macaw is acting oddly, exhibiting open mouth breathing or gasping for air or is fluffed up and lethargic it could be trying to lay an egg. The eggs can exert pressure on the nerves controlling the legs, which can cause self-mutilation and paralysis. If you notice this behavior you should contact your veterinarian or animal emergency clinic.
